6. Avoid Duplicate Content on Your Website

Leslie Handmaker, Senior Digital Marketing Strategist, Paycor

Clean up duplicate content that can be inadvertently made by your content management system (CMS). Some content programs will append URLs with parameters, and the end result is multiple URLs with the exact same material. This can confuse search engines. The fix would be to utilize self-referencing canonical tags. The self-referencing canonicals let search engines know which URL is your preferred version. An additional plus is that they can provide you a bit of a safety net if your website gets scraped by bots and your content is used without your authorization on third party sites.

12. Be Consistent With Your Company Details Online

Kristan Bauer, Creator and SEO Specialist, KristanBauer.com

Among the biggest mistakes neighborhood or small business owners can make is using their telephone, address and business name (permanent account number or PAN) record. Maintaining consistency throughout all locations where your PAN is recorded can lead to better local rankings, specifically in the neighborhood map pack. This could be as little as abbreviating a street address versus spelling out it entirely (for instance,”Ave.” vs.”Avenue”). A business’s PAN needs to be 100% consistent across all possessed stations, including site, social media profiles, Google My Business (GMB) and Yelp. This won’t only assist customers find your company correctly but it will also ensure your organization citations are constant throughout the web.

13. Optimize the Use of Title Tags

Kirk Bates, Owner, Market 248

Begin with the one search-engine item which will give you the maximum impact for your attempt. Among the most powerful SEO components on the webpage is the title tag. Title tags are a huge indicator to hunt engines of exactly what your page is about. Your title tag should contain the very best key words related to the page you’re working on, and those key words should be put at the beginning of your title tag. By Way of Example, for a local business that sells the most delicious, freshly made donuts in town, the name tag could be structured like this:

Fresh Hot Delicious Donuts | Donut Heaven | Chattanooga TN

The structure that I used is main key words — brand — location. Your name tag should be a clear outline of what is on the page or website and ought to be between 55 and 65 characters , including spaces. My example above is 58 characters.

14. Don’t Forget About Your Site Images

Iskra Evtimova, SEO Specialist, IskraEvtimova.com

People usually think images are only for the visual impact, but this isn’t true. You are missing in the event that you do not optimize your images so remember to use a key word in the file name before uploading the picture, and then add image title and alt tag feature with a key word. You should also assess the size of this file before you upload it to your site. Be mindful to compress the picture. The larger files make the site load slower, and the loading rate is an SEO ranking factor.

19. Pay Attention to Your Site Rate

Maggie Barr, SEO Marketing Manager, AmTrust Financial

Speed matters. With the move to mobile-first indexing, Google has stated that beginning this summer page speed will be a ranking factor for mobile searches. While there will be several actionable things, frequently compressing your images is a simple triumph to earn your website speed faster. Work with your IT department to understand what can be achieved and the degree of work involved. HTTP/2 is also a excellent way to observe improvements for site safety, speed and efficacy. If your site is already protected, based on your hosting provider or content delivery network, it might be rather straightforward to enable.

25. Find Low-competition Keywords

Tom Casano, SEO Expert and Advisor, Sure Oak

If you wanted to rank for”buy computer,” you’d need to compete against the likes of Best Buy and Amazon. However if you rather sought to rank for”best Dell notebooks in 2018,” you’d have much less competition and you’d stand a fighting chance to position. By targeting long-tail keywords, you’ll get a higher likelihood of standing, and acquiring cumulative search volume out of multiple, less competitive search phrases. These are keywords that you’re more inclined to rank for as an underdog.
